Mets general manager Sandy Alderson said he's in an "ongoing discussion" with Michael Bourn's agent, Scott Boras.
"Realistically, the outfield situation is set with that possible exception," Alderson said. "My expectation is we'll go into spring training with what we have unless something were to transpire in the free-agent market." Boras wants a five-year deal for his client, but the Mets are unwilling to go beyond three years. The Mets are also hesitant to surrender the No. 11 pick, but they might be willing to do so if they think they're getting Bourn at a discounted rate.
